Former world number one Naomi Osaka shared her feelings after winning the WTA 125 tournament in Saint-Malo, France. In the final, the Japanese star defeated Kaia Juvan with a score of 6/1, 7/5.
“It`s funny that my first trophy since coming back came on clay, a surface I used to consider my weakest,” Osaka posted on social media. “But that`s one of the things I love about life: there`s always a chance to grow and change.”
“Thank you to everyone who has been with me on this journey. It`s been bumpy at times, but incredibly exciting, and I`m really grateful for it,” she added.
